MODULE, Fuel Pump: Installation: Installation

CAUTION: Whenever the fuel pump module is serviced, the rubber seal (gasket) must be replaced.
  1. Using a new seal (gasket), position fuel pump module into opening in fuel tank.
  2. Position lockring (5) over top of fuel pump module.
  3. Rotate module until embossed alignment arrow points to center alignment mark. This step must be performed to prevent float from contacting side of fuel tank. Also be sure fuel fittings on top of pump module are pointed to right side of vehicle.
  4. Install Lockring Remover/Installer 9340 (3) to lockring.
  5. Install 1/2 inch drive breaker (1) into Lockring Remover/Installer 9340 (3).
  6. Tighten lockring (clockwise) until all seven notches have engaged.

  7. Connect pigtail harness connector (2) to pump module (7).
  8. Connect fittings (3) and (6) to pump module. See Standard Procedure .
  9. Install fuel tank. See Installation .
